Any fans of Final Fantasy 5 here?  I have it on my PS1 Final Fantasy Anthology collection (FF6 is my personal favorite followed by FF9...but that's a whole other thread).

 

It is an honest shame we didn't originally get it in North America as the whole job system was thought to be confusing to American & Canadian players.  I'll be honest - the job system is the best part of the game as besides customizing characters, it adds significant strategy.  You have to have a balance of characters with proper abilities and you need to master a number of classes by game's end to make a really potent party.  

 

The way I went was usually Bartz as my heavy hitter (Knight, Samurai, Berserker, Sorceror), Lena as support magic (White Mage, Time Mage, etc), Faris as attack magic (Black Mage, Summoner, etc) and Galuf/Lena as support and backup (Blue Mage, Ninja, Thief, Bard, etc).  After two failed attempts to beat the game, due to poor planning, I finally beat it last year.  I had two characters as the bare class (with several mastered classes and available abilities) backed up by two Mime classes who mimicked the really powerful attacks.

One of the features I liked was Krile replacing Galuf (yes, I made a mistake in above post) and Krile getting her grandfather's abilities.  Galuf's death is also a gut punch - I was not used to a main player character dying off like that mid-game.  

 

As for the classes, I liked the various fighting classes in the game.  The Knight was a staple character as it was the first fighting class you got.  I kept that until I got the crystals for the Berserker and Samurai class.  Towards the end of the game, when you have all that money and don't need to buy new weapons, the Samurai's coin tossing ability can be very destructive.

 

The Red Mage was difficult but awesome.  It took about 999 ability points to learn the Red Mage's Dualcast ability.  I saved that for near the end of the game and Dualcast comes in handy in the final boss bottle as I can cast multiple destructive spells with that ability.
